§ 37-21-2 — Secretary as inspector and sealer--Enforcement of standards--Powers and duties of department personnel.
The secretary is the ex officio inspector and sealer of weights and measures and shall enforce the provisions of chapters 37-20 and 37-21 . A deputy, assistant, or inspector appointed by the secretary has the same powers and duties provided to the secretary when acting in performance of duties assigned by the secretary under the provisions of this chapter.

Legislative History
SDC 1939, § 63.0101; SL 1996, ch 320 (Ex. Ord. 96-1), §§ 19, 20; SL 2003, ch 272 (Ex. Ord. 03-1), § 23; SL 2016, ch 183, § 22.
